What is a Conservatory?
A conservatory is typically defined as a space or structure that is predominantly made from glass and is connected to a home. The main function of a conservatory is to create a space that integrates indoor convenience with the natural beauty of the outside environment. Conservatories can serve various functions, consisting of:

1. Do I need planning approval to build a conservatory?In lots of cases, conservatories fall under permitted development, which indicates preparation authorization might not be required. However, it is essential to examine local guidelines as requirements might differ. 2. Just how much does it cost to build a conservatory?The cost of a

conservatory can differ significantly based on its size, products, and design. Typically, property owners can expect to invest anywhere from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more. 3. Can a conservatory be utilized year-round? While standard conservatories are often
developed for seasonal use, modern products and heating solutions enable year-round use, making them ideal for all seasons. 4. Which materials are best for a conservatory?Common products include uPVC, wood, and aluminum for the frame, while double-glazing is suggested for the glass to enhance insulation. 5. For how long does it take to build a conservatory?The construction time for a conservatory can differ, typically ranging from 6 weeks to 12 weeks, depending on its intricacy and aspects such as climate condition.
